Background technique
Hoist engine reel winding wire ropes or chain lifting or the light and small heavy-duty hoisting equipment of traction, also known as winch. Hoist engine can with vertical-lift, horizontally or diagonally drag and draw weight.Hoist engine is divided into manual hoist, electrical hoist and hydraulic volume Raise three kinds of machine.Now based on electrical hoist.Can be used alone, can also make lifting, build the road in the machinery such as mine hoisting Building block is widely applied due to easy to operate, wiring amount is big, dislocation facilitates.Mainly apply to building, hydraulic engineering, forestry, The material of mine, harbour etc. goes up and down or puts down and drags.
Hoist engine on the market must be fixed with earth anchor at present, to prevent generating sliding when work or toppling.According to by Power size, wire rope hoist have bolt anchoring method, horizontal anchoring method, staking out anchoring method and ballast to anchor four kinds of method, this fixation Although mode is firm, time is long, and can there are the drillings of earth anchor on the ground, therefore one kind is developed in market in urgent need The hoist engine being easily installed is existing to help people to solve the problems, such as.
